<?xml version="1.0" encoding="koi8-r"?>
<rss version="0.91">
<channel>
    <title>OpenForum RSS: модуль com-порта</title>
    <link>https://www.opennet.ru/openforum/vsluhforumID9/6505.html</link>
    <description>Здравствуйте! Пытаюсь переписать драйвер ком-порта, основываясь на стандартном serial.c (Linux с ядром 2.2.20).&lt;br&gt;Откомпилировал, создал serial.o. Пытаюсь загрузить его - insmod serial.o&lt;br&gt;Выдаётся куча ошибок unresolved symbol. Хотел все недостающие модули подгрузить, но первая же попытка привела к новой куче unresolved symbol. Гружу модуль из нового списка - тоже самое. Как это обойти?</description>

<item>
    <title>модуль com-порта (Serg2208)</title>
    <link>https://www.opennet.ru/openforum/vsluhforumID9/6505.html#4</link>
    <pubDate>Mon, 18 Apr 2011 10:18:03 GMT</pubDate>
    <description>&amp;gt;&#091;оверквотинг удален&#093;&lt;br&gt;&amp;gt;&amp;gt; &lt;br&gt;&amp;gt;&amp;gt;MCBC &amp;lt;имя компа&amp;gt; 2.2.20-MCBC #1 &amp;lt;дата&amp;gt; i686 unknown &lt;br&gt;&amp;gt; а я думал ОС2000 :) &lt;br&gt;&amp;gt;&amp;gt;&amp;gt; и узнать способ сборки модуля.&lt;br&gt;&amp;gt;&amp;gt;Привожу  Makefile: &lt;br&gt;&amp;gt;&amp;gt; &lt;br&gt;&amp;gt;&amp;gt;CC = gcc &lt;br&gt;&amp;gt;&amp;gt;MODFLAGS := -Wall -DMODULE -D__KERNEL__ -DLINUX -I/usr/src/linux/include/ &lt;br&gt;&amp;gt;&amp;gt;serial.o : serial.c /usr/src/linux/include/linux/version.h &lt;br&gt;&amp;gt;&amp;gt; $(CC) $(MODFLAGS) -c serial.c &lt;br&gt;&lt;br&gt;Возникла такая же проблема с &quot;unresolved symbol&quot; в com драйвере для МСВС! makefile такой же, библиотеки ошибок и  варнингов не дают, но модуль всё равно не подгружается в ядро! Если кто решил проблему - просьба отписаться здесь!&lt;br&gt;</description>
</item>

<item>
    <title>модуль com-порта (int _0dh)</title>
    <link>https://www.opennet.ru/openforum/vsluhforumID9/6505.html#3</link>
    <pubDate>Thu, 31 May 2007 17:44:41 GMT</pubDate>
    <description>&amp;gt;&amp;gt;телепаты традиционно в отпуске. &lt;br&gt;&amp;gt;А жаль :) &lt;br&gt;&amp;gt;&amp;gt;для начала бы хотелось увидеть dmesg после insmod, &lt;br&gt;&amp;gt;insmod serial.o выдаёт: &lt;br&gt;&amp;gt;&lt;br&gt;&amp;gt;serial.o: unresolved symbol test_and_clear_bit &lt;br&gt;&amp;gt;serial.o: unresolved symbol strcat &lt;br&gt;&amp;gt;serial.o: unresolved symbol get_free_page &lt;br&gt;&amp;gt;serial.o: unresolved symbol inb &lt;br&gt;&amp;gt;serial.o: unresolved symbol __put_user_X &lt;br&gt;&amp;gt;serial.o: unresolved symbol __get_user_X &lt;br&gt;&amp;gt;serial.o: unresolved symbol run_task_queue &lt;br&gt;&amp;gt;serial.o: unresolved symbol remove_wait_queue &lt;br&gt;&amp;gt;serial.o: unresolved symbol __constant_memcpy &lt;br&gt;&amp;gt;serial.o: unresolved symbol __constant_c_memset &lt;br&gt;&amp;gt;serial.o: unresolved symbol queue_task &lt;br&gt;&amp;gt;serial.o: unresolved symbol down &lt;br&gt;&amp;gt;serial.o: unresolved symbol remove_bh &lt;br&gt;&amp;gt;serial.o: unresolved symbol __memcpy &lt;br&gt;&amp;gt;serial.o: unresolved symbol init_bh &lt;br&gt;&amp;gt;serial.o: unresolved symbol mark_bh &lt;br&gt;&amp;gt;serial.o: unresolved symbol add_wait_queue &lt;br&gt;&amp;gt;serial.o: unresolved symbol signal_pending &lt;br&gt;&amp;gt;serial.o: unresolved symbol up &lt;br&gt;&amp;gt;serial.o: unresolved symbol __constant_c_and_count_memset &lt;br&gt;&amp;gt;serial.o: unre</description>
</item>

<item>
    <title>модуль com-порта (yuriam)</title>
    <link>https://www.opennet.ru/openforum/vsluhforumID9/6505.html#2</link>
    <pubDate>Thu, 31 May 2007 05:24:08 GMT</pubDate>
    <description>&amp;gt;телепаты традиционно в отпуске. &lt;br&gt;А жаль :)&lt;br&gt;&amp;gt;для начала бы хотелось увидеть dmesg после insmod, &lt;br&gt;insmod serial.o выдаёт:&lt;br&gt;&lt;br&gt;serial.o: unresolved symbol test_and_clear_bit&lt;br&gt;serial.o: unresolved symbol strcat&lt;br&gt;serial.o: unresolved symbol get_free_page&lt;br&gt;serial.o: unresolved symbol inb&lt;br&gt;serial.o: unresolved symbol __put_user_X&lt;br&gt;serial.o: unresolved symbol __get_user_X&lt;br&gt;serial.o: unresolved symbol run_task_queue&lt;br&gt;serial.o: unresolved symbol remove_wait_queue&lt;br&gt;serial.o: unresolved symbol __constant_memcpy&lt;br&gt;serial.o: unresolved symbol __constant_c_memset&lt;br&gt;serial.o: unresolved symbol queue_task&lt;br&gt;serial.o: unresolved symbol down&lt;br&gt;serial.o: unresolved symbol remove_bh&lt;br&gt;serial.o: unresolved symbol __memcpy&lt;br&gt;serial.o: unresolved symbol init_bh&lt;br&gt;serial.o: unresolved symbol mark_bh&lt;br&gt;serial.o: unresolved symbol add_wait_queue&lt;br&gt;serial.o: unresolved symbol signal_pending&lt;br&gt;serial.o: unresolved symbol up&lt;br&gt;serial.o: unresolved symbol __constant_c_and_count_memset&lt;br&gt;serial.o: unresolved symbol __constant_test_bit&lt;br&gt;serial.o: unr</description>
</item>

<item>
    <title>модуль com-порта (int _0dh)</title>
    <link>https://www.opennet.ru/openforum/vsluhforumID9/6505.html#1</link>
    <pubDate>Wed, 30 May 2007 17:57:34 GMT</pubDate>
    <description>&amp;gt;Здравствуйте! Пытаюсь переписать драйвер ком-порта, основываясь на стандартном serial.c (Linux с ядром &lt;br&gt;&amp;gt;2.2.20). &lt;br&gt;&amp;gt;Откомпилировал, создал serial.o. Пытаюсь загрузить его - insmod serial.o &lt;br&gt;&amp;gt;Выдаётся куча ошибок unresolved symbol. Хотел все недостающие модули подгрузить, но первая &lt;br&gt;&amp;gt;же попытка привела к новой куче unresolved symbol. Гружу модуль из &lt;br&gt;&amp;gt;нового списка - тоже самое. Как это обойти? &lt;br&gt;телепаты традиционно в отпуске.&lt;br&gt;для начала бы хотелось увидеть dmesg после insmod,&lt;br&gt;uname -a на таргете, и узнать способ сборки модуля.&lt;br&gt;&lt;br&gt;</description>
</item>

</channel>
</rss>
